Checking your divorce case status involves understanding the various stages your case might go through. From filing the initial petition to finalizing the divorce decree, each step has its own timeline and requirements.
Key Stages in Divorce Case Status:
- Filing and Serving: Initiating the process by filing a petition and serving it to your spouse.
- Response and Discovery: Your spouse’s response and the exchange of information.
- Negotiation and Settlement: Attempting to reach an agreement outside of court.
- Trial and Judgment: Court hearings if settlement fails, leading to a judge’s decision.
To check your divorce case status, you can often use online court portals provided by your local jurisdiction. These platforms allow you to track the progress of your case using a unique case number. How to Check Your Divorce Case Status Online: A Step-by-Step Guide
Navigating the complexities of family law can be overwhelming, especially when you’re eager to know the status of your divorce case. Fortunately, checking your divorce case status online has become more accessible, saving you time and reducing stress. This guide will walk you through the process, ensuring you stay informed every step of the way.
Step 1: Gather Necessary Information
Before you start, make sure you have all relevant details at hand. This includes your case number, the names of the parties involved, and the court where your case is filed. Having this information ready will streamline the process.
Step 2: Visit the Court’s Website
Most courts offer online portals where you can check your divorce case status. Simply search for the court’s official website where your case is filed. Look for sections like “Case Status” or “Online Services.”
- Navigate to the Family Law Section: This is where you’ll find specific information related to divorce cases.
- Enter Your Case Details: Input your case number and other required information to access your case status.

Exploring Offline Methods: Checking Your Divorce Case Status in Person
Understanding the status of your divorce case is crucial for planning your next steps and ensuring a smooth transition. While online methods are convenient, exploring offline methods can provide a more personal touch and immediate answers. Here’s how you can check your divorce case status in person.
Visit the Courthouse
One of the most direct ways to check your divorce case status is by visiting the courthouse where your case was filed. This allows you to speak directly with court clerks who can provide updates and clarify any confusion. Remember to bring your case number and identification for a seamless experience.

FAQs
1. How can I check the status of my divorce case?
You can check the status of your divorce case by visiting the court’s official website, using your case number, or contacting the court clerk. Some jurisdictions also provide case tracking via SMS or email.
2. How long does it take for a divorce case to be finalized?
The duration varies depending on the complexity of the case, the jurisdiction, and whether it is contested or uncontested. It can take anywhere from a few months to several years.
3. What does “case pending” mean in a divorce case?
“Case pending” means that the court is still processing your case, and a final judgment has not yet been issued.
4. Can I speed up my divorce case?
Yes, you can speed up the process by ensuring all required documents are submitted correctly, reaching agreements with your spouse outside of court, and responding promptly to court requests.
5. What happens if my spouse does not respond to the divorce petition?
If your spouse does not respond within the required timeframe, the court may grant a default judgment, finalizing the divorce without their participation.
6. How will I know when my divorce is finalized?
You will receive a final divorce decree from the court, either through mail, online access, or from your attorney.
